Designates March twenty-first as Down Syndrome Awareness Day

NY · session 2025-2026 · Senate · bill

A state bill is a proposed law in a state legislature — separate from the U.S. Congress. Learn more →

Introduced Jan 28, 2025

Latest action (Jun 1, 2026) REFERRED TO GOVERNMENTAL OPERATIONS

Summary

Designates March twenty-first as a day of commemoration to be known as "Down Syndrome Awareness Day".
